Monday 17th July marked the end of Year 1 for the first group of apprentices at our training centre, Carr’s Engineering Skills Academy in association with Lakes College. It’s been a great year, with a high number of Distinction grades awarded for completed units so far, we are extremely pleased with their performance, and there have been zero accidents! It’s truly impressive to see the improvement in the quality of work being produced by students since opening last year. We couldn’t be happier with the progress of the centre and the way it’s shaping up for the future.
